Former West Ham United striker Carlton Cole has supported the club signing Samir Nasri.
The Hammers have allowed the former Arsenal and Manchester City to train with them as he attempts to win a six-month contract.
The 31-year-old's 18-month suspension ends in January and Cole thinks he could provide something different for Manuel Pellegrini's side.
"I think the manager has a good relationship with him," Cole told Sky Sports. "We know his class, he's a classy player.
"He will bring something different to the squad and he has that experience too.
"It will be a great addition to the squad but it depends what the manager wants and what the owners want."
